## Runbook: ScaleWise Restart Procedure

ScaleWise is the recipe-scaling calculator service behind the Pantrella kitchen app. Before restarting, confirm that the unit-conversion cache has flushed, otherwise scaled quantities may be served from stale ratios. Restart only one node at a time and watch the conversion-error gauge for five minutes. The service must come back up with the following configuration.

service settings:
[silwyn]
host = silwyn.crelvogrid.internal
user = silwyn_svc
database = silwyn_prod

Handover note — Crumbwheel order cutoffs.

Welcome aboard. The bakery cutoff rule in Crumbwheel closes same-day orders at 14:00 local to each storefront, not UTC — this has bitten us twice. Holiday overrides live in the calendar service and take precedence silently, so always check there first when a cutoff looks wrong. To unlock the calendar service's admin console after a restart, enter the recovery passphrase below.

vault phrase of bagap-bahaf = silion-pelox-sorox-casdor-quenwyn-fraax-eliox-praael-kelion-quenvan-kasox-rusael-norius-belvan

// Heads up for the release manager: this client batches resolver calls
// through the Marigold dataloader service, which is what finally killed
// the GraphQL N+1 mess on the orders page. Don't ship without it — query
// counts drop from ~400 to 6 per request. It authenticates with the key
// directly below.

app token of yajeg-kawef = kto11_7En3XSX8xQw

From: P. Arnevik, outgoing Commercial Director
To: S. Delmore, incoming

Subject: Retirement of the Fenwick Meter line

Sandrine — the Fenwick line sunsets over the next three quarters. Finance should watch three items: remaining component commitments with Varga Industrial, the warranty reserve (currently adequate but review at each close), and deferred revenue on multi-year service plans, which must be unwound carefully. Customer migration offers go out next month. Before you take this forward, one confidential point on our plans sits below.

internal memo for kawip-hadug: Headcount on the Wenwyn team goes from 7 to 140 by the end of January. Gross margin on Wenwyn came in at 20 percent against a plan of 15 percent.